MGTurbo
24th November 2003, 15:15
I re-used mine. No mention of them being stretch bolts. As long as they have no corrosion i'd be happy to re-use them once or twice. Mine were in excellent condition, but still exercised caution when torquing them up, the final 90 degrees is very nerve racking as it feel like they are going to snap off! But through cleaning of the bolt holes and wire brushing the threads, followed by light machine oil, meant they screwed in with no problems.
